Similarly, the services and features offered at Five Oaks RV & MH Park are not detailed in the provided information. Typically, RV parks offer a range of amenities to ensure a comfortable stay for travelers. These can include:
- RV hookups: Providing connections for electricity, water, and sewer. The availability and type of hookups (e.g., 30 amp, 50 amp) are important considerations for RV owners.
- Site types: Including pull-through sites for easier access for larger RVs and back-in sites. The size and surface (e.g., gravel, concrete) of the sites can also vary.
- Restroom and shower facilities: Clean and well-maintained restrooms and showers are essential amenities.
- Laundry facilities: Offering coin-operated or card-operated washers and dryers for guests' convenience.
- Wi-Fi access: Increasingly expected by travelers to stay connected.
- Recreational areas: Such as picnic tables, BBQ grills, playgrounds, or communal gathering spaces.
- Security features: Including well-lit grounds, on-site management, or security cameras.
